Dell's Q4 Preview Reinforces AI Growth Amid Valuation and Execution Risks

What happened

Seeking Alpha previews Dell's Q4 2026 earnings with bullish expectations, citing AI infrastructure momentum and strong ISG segment performance. DeepValue's master report maintains a HOLD rating, acknowledging Dell's AI positioning but highlighting stretched valuation metrics and persistent execution risks. The report cautions that mix pressure from lower-margin AI-optimized servers and competitive CSG pricing could compress margins, despite management's guidance aligning with consensus. Additionally, risks like customer concentration and supply constraints for accelerators add uncertainty to the growth trajectory. Overall, while AI demand supports revenue growth, investors must critically assess whether Dell can overcome margin headwinds to justify its premium valuation.

Implication

Dell's Q4 guidance suggests continued top-line strength from AI infrastructure, but margin compression from AI server mix may hinder profit expansion, keeping earnings growth in check. The elevated valuation, with a P/E of ~23 and EV/EBITDA of ~103, leaves little room for error, requiring sustained execution to avoid downside. Competitive pressures in the CSG segment and potential supply chain bottlenecks for critical components like GPUs add operational risks that could derail management's outlook. Long-term, Dell's scale and direct liquid cooling expertise provide a competitive moat, but near-term profitability and cash flow generation are critical to support the stock. Therefore, monitoring Q4 results for margin trends and supply chain execution is essential before considering any upgrade from the current HOLD stance.
